Cattle with only one copy of the gene, … Witryna1 cze 2016 · A properly functioning immune system should protect dairy cows from a variety of pathogenic organisms, including viruses, bacteria, and parasites. To accomplish this task, the immune system utilizes a complex and dynamic network of tissues, cells, and molecules that can be conveniently separated into 2 distinct …

WitrynaWhen developing a vaccination strategy, several factors must be considered. Some of these factors are: Class of cattle (age) Nursing calves, weaned calves, yearling cattle, replacement heifers, pregnant cows, open cows, breeding bulls. Production system the cattle are in.
